Vankaya Pachi Pulusu – Roasted brinjal – Raw tamarind Stew

Vankaya Pachi Pulusu – Roasted brinjal – Raw tamarind Stew

Pachi (raw) Pulusu (stew prepared with tamarind) is a traditional classic Andhra dish, made with simple ingredients and served with hot steamed rice, mudda pappu (cooked tur dal) and vadiyalu. Vankaya Chikkudu Ginjalu Mudda Kura – Brinjal Lima Beans Curry

Vankaya Chikkudu Ginjalu Mudda Kura – Brinjal Lima Beans Curry

Lima beans and eggplants are one of my all time favorite vegetable combinations. We prepare a mudda kura (a hotch potch of sorts) where plump beans merge with soft eggplants and ginger-garlic-green chillis-coriander paste to create a flavorful Andhra classic that is sure to brighten up one’s meal.
